CMS Invites Feedback on Public Data Collection Burdens and Usefulness

Published Date: 3/17/2026

Notice

Summary

The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) wants your thoughts on their plan to collect info from the public. This helps make sure the questions they ask aren’t too much work and actually useful. If you have ideas or concerns, you’ve got until April 16, 2026, to speak up—no money changes yet, just a chance to improve how info is gathered.

Face-to-Face Documentation Burden

If you are a physician or an authorized non-physician practitioner who certifies Medicaid home health services, you must document a face-to-face encounter before certifying that home health is needed. CMS estimates 381,785 respondents, 2,495,355 total annual responses, and 416,724 total annual hours to complete this documentation (writing/typing/dictating and signing/dating).

Expanded Authority for NPs, CNSs, and PAs

Section 3708 of the CARES Act and CMS action allow nurse practitioners, clinical nurse specialists, and physician assistants to certify and order Medicare and Medicaid home health services and to perform the required face-to-face encounter independently for patients they order services for, in accordance with state law. CMS amended 42 CFR 440.70 to remove the prior requirement that authorized non-physician practitioners communicate the clinical finding to the ordering physician.
